Belden Premium Series Hook Up Wire, 0.52mm² Cross Sectional Area, Blue Sheath Colour - 3053 BL005


This hook up wire is designed for a wide range of electrical applications, featuring a blue PVC insulation that ensures durability and high performance. With a cross-sectional area of 0.52mm² and a single core construction, this wire is suitable for various automation and electronic projects where reliability is paramount. It offers a maximum length of 30m and is rated for operation between -40°C and +105°C.

What type of materials make this wire suitable for harsh environments?


The wire features PVC insulation, which is specifically designed to resist various oils, solvents, and chemicals, enhancing its durability in challenging conditions.

How does the temperature range impact the applications of this wire?


Operating efficiently between -40°C and +105°C, it is perfect for environments that experience extreme temperatures, ensuring reliable performance across different applications.

Which electrical standards does this wire meet for safety?


It is BS Listed under the AWM/STYLE 1007 and 1569, confirming its compliance with acceptable safety standards for various electrical applications.

What advantages does using tinned copper provide in this wire?


Tinned copper enhances corrosion resistance and maintains conductivity over time, making it a reliable option for extended use in different installations.
